Deathsu Posted March 19 Share Posted March 19 Please bring back the old trending sort function. This was functionally different than endorsement/downloads/unique downloads sorts as it looked at rate of interest by the community within a time-division rather than total interest all time. The current trending and popular mods sections and tabs are either functionally broken or mislabeled. Currently, trending can only show total endorsements all time filtered by mod release time frame, and popular is the same thing substituting in total downloads all time. The way these should work is sort based on total endorsements/downloads filtered by time frame, filtered by mod release time frame. This does a better job a showing where the current interest in the community is at a given time. 8 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

dezerte Posted March 19 Share Posted March 19 I think the first rollout was mostly fine. I thought the contrasting colors change in the recent activity tab made it easier to read. However I did not like the new search pop-up window, it obscures too much of the website preventing you from using the site without closing down the pop-up. The second rollout hit me today, radically changing the landing page for each game. It feels more compact and so far I'm finding it confusing and harder to find and discover mods. This, along with first rollout has resulted in more clicks/key presses being needed to navigate the site. The black background behind the mod tiles is probably a big issue for readability - mod tiles don't "pop out" any longer. It was previously lighter or used a varied image as a background which I think made the contrast more clear and visible. Overall, I think the site UI update made the website look more modern, more sleek. However, it reduced usability.
